Understanding Risk

Before diving into specific strategies, it’s essential to grasp the concept of risk. Every investment or gamble carries its inherent risks. The key is to identify those risks and develop a plan to manage them effectively. Start by assessing your risk tolerance, which reflects how much loss you can endure without impacting your emotional well-being.

Set a Budget

One of the most effective ways to avoid losing too much money is to establish a clear budget. This budget should reflect your financial situation and how much you are willing to spend on gambling or investing.

Learn the Rules of the Game

Whether you’re playing poker, blackjack, or engaging in stock trading, understanding the rules is critical. Take the time to educate yourself before placing any bets or investments.

Emotional Control

Maintaining emotional control is vital in avoiding significant losses. It’s easy to get caught up in the thrill of winning or the despair of losing, but emotional decisions often lead to poor outcomes.

Know When to Quit

The ability to walk away is an essential trait for anyone looking to minimize losses. Knowing when to quit can mean the difference between massive financial losses and smart exits.

Embrace a Learning Mindset

Every experience, win or lose, is an opportunity to learn. Embracing a growth mindset can significantly reduce the likelihood of future losses. Reflect on your strategies and outcomes to identify what works and what doesn’t.
